JTAG, ARM, gdb og linux

Hej

Jeg sidder og prøver at få hul igennem til et jtag-interface på en atmel arm7 kreds.

Jeg har fået openocd op at køre og fået hul igennem til kredsen. Spørgsmålet er nu hvordan jeg får gdb til at spille sammen med openocd?

Skal gdb være cross-compilet til arm-kredsen eller hvordan gøres dette? Og hvordan forbinder jeg gdb til openocd? Hvordan loades den kompilerede kode til RAM og eksekveres herfra?

Med venlig hilsen

Preben Holm

Reply to
Preben
Loading thread data ...

Ja, det gøres ved at læse lidt i GDB readme filerne :o) hint: Donwload GDB source koden fra:

formatting link
Pakke koden ud i Linux/Cygwin og udføre noget i stil med: $ ./configure --target=arm-elf $ make $ make install

Det kommer an på hvordan OpenOCD enumereres på PC'en. Som en COM port eller en LPT port?

Læs GDB manualen :o) Eller også er Google din ven.

/Thomas

Reply to
Thomas Lykkeberg

ElectronDepot website is not affiliated with any of the manufacturers or service providers discussed here. All logos and trade names are the property of their respective owners.